BELOW THE CLIFFS AND ABOVE THE TIDE
Another "Dancing into Elemental Art" weekend
20th and 21st March 2010
A weekend of creative expression inspired by an elemental walk on the beach below fossil cliffs and beside the sparkling sea. Our experience will inspire a truly creative weekend of movement, design, dance, paint, stitch and making. Come and find your creative self.
The weekend will begin with a walk of discovery on Eype Beach near Bridport followed by a move to the village hall at Salway Ash to interpret our experiences and findings through creative dance, painting, writing and making. Some or all of these activities will be initiated by dancing our interpretations.
All are welcome, no experience is necessary, just a desire to be creative or find out if you are. The course will be gently led and is for all ages. Children need to be accompanied by an adult.
The course aims to create a group response to the meeting place of the sea and the land.

WORKSHOP - "DANCING INTO ELEMENTAL ART". Led by Wendy Hermelin and Caroline Mayall. 16th and 17th May 2009 - Salway Ash near Bridport
A weekend of creative expression inspired by the magical heart of West Dorset. Amidst ancient hill forts and wind-blown beacons, fossil cliffs and the sparkling sea, we shall find elemental scenes to inspire a truly creative weekend of dancing, painting, stitching and making. We shall integrate these art forms to express aspects of the four elements that are found here in force.
Come and find your creative self.
THIS WAS A VERY SUCCESSFUL WEEKEND. ON OUR WALK UP LEWESDON HILL THE SUN SHONE, THE WIND BLEW A HOWLING GALE AND THE BUTTERCUPS, BLUEBELLS AND RED CAMPION GLOWED BRIGHTLY BENEATH THE NEW GREEN OF THE BEECH LEAVES. WHEN WE RETURNED TO THE HALL THE SKY DARKENED BENEATH HUGE CLOUDS AND THE RAIN LASHED DOWN. WE DANCED AND MADE ELEMENTAL THINGS AS A RESULT!
